What Is Backflow Testing?


What is backflow?


Backflow occurs when suction draws dirty water into a clean water supply. It can be an issue with residential and commercial irrigation systems, as well as businesses that use potentially hazardous materials.


What is a backflow preventer?


A backflow preventer is a check valve unit. The valves in this device keep contaminated water from reversing into your clean water system. The type of backflow preventer that’s needed for your property depends on your risk for backflow.


What is backflow testing?


Backflow testing is required on a regular (usually annual) basis to make sure your backflow preventer is working properly. The test ensures that proper pressure is maintained within the device and that it’s capable of stopping the backflow of contaminated water.
